Understanding Bias and Emotion in Soccer Betting

In the thrilling world of soccer betting, bias and emotion can cloud judgment and lead to poor decision-making. Many bettors make the mistake of allowing personal feelings, such as loyalty to a favorite team or discontent towards rivals, to influence their betting choices. This emotional investment can result in skewed perceptions of a team’s actual performance or prospects. Recognizing the impact of these emotions is crucial; for instance, overriding logical assessment with nostalgia for past successes or current team loyalties can lead to significant losses. Consider the following common biases:

  • Confirmation Bias: Seeking information that supports previously held beliefs.
  • Recency Bias: Overvaluing recent performances at the expense of historical data.
  • Homer Bias: Betting more favorably on a local team regardless of actual statistics.

Moreover, the interplay of bias and emotion can distort a bettor’s ability to analyze a match objectively. Engaging with reliable data and analytical tools is essential for making informed bets. Bettors are encouraged to look beyond surface-level narratives, avoiding emotional pitfalls while assessing teams based on measurable outcomes such as team form, head-to-head statistics, injuries, and external factors. Recognizing the Importance of Bankroll Management

Effective bankroll management is paramount for anyone delving into the thrilling world of soccer betting. Without a solid plan, punters can quickly find themselves in over their heads, chasing losses or betting impulsively during unpredictable matches. Establishing a financial strategy not only helps in minimizing risks but also enhances the overall betting experience. For instance, setting aside a specific percentage of your total funds for each bet can create discipline and ensure longevity in your betting pursuits.

To implement effective bankroll management, consider the following strategies:

  • Determine a betting budget: Decide how much money you can afford to lose without it affecting your daily life.
  • Set limits on betting amounts: Use a fixed stake system or a percentage of your bankroll for each wager.
  • Track your bets: Maintain a record of wins and losses to analyze your betting patterns.

By integrating these principles, you can avoid the pitfalls of reckless gambling. Remember that successful betting isn’t just about winning—it’s also about managing your resources wisely.

Assessing Team Form Beyond the Standings

When evaluating a soccer team’s potential, relying solely on their current league standings can lead to misguided judgments. Form is a complex tapestry of factors that transcends numbers, requiring a deeper look at recent performances, player dynamics, and tactical approaches. To better understand how a team truly performs, consider the following:

  • Recent Fixtures: Analyze the last five to ten matches to gauge consistency and momentum.
  • Opposition Strength: Evaluate the quality of teams faced during recent games; victories against lower-ranked teams may mask underlying issues.
  • Injuries and Suspensions: Keep track of key player absences which can drastically alter a team’s effectiveness.
  • Home vs. Away Performance: Some teams thrive at home while struggling on the road, showcasing a need to evaluate the context of results.

Additionally, team morale and psychology play a significant role in performances that statistics often overlook. The difference between a squad in good spirits and one demoralized by defeat can be monumental. Pay attention to:

  • Coaching Stability: A change in management can drive a team into a resurgence or a decline, impacting immediate results.
  • Player Confidence: Observe the players who display passion and confidence; these elements can turn games around.
  • Media and Fans Influence: The pressure from fans and media can affect team dynamics, especially in high-stakes matches.

Navigating the Pitfalls of Incomplete Research

In the fast-paced world of soccer betting, it’s easy to overlook the depth and breadth of research necessary to make informed decisions. One common pitfall is relying solely on superficial statistics or recent performances. Bettors may focus on the last few matches, ignoring critical factors like player injuries, historical matchups, or the playing conditions. To avoid this trap, consider a more comprehensive approach by analyzing various data points, including:

  • Team Form: Look at the team’s performance over several games rather than just the latest results.
  • Head-to-Head Records: Historical data between the teams can reveal patterns that influence outcomes.
  • Player Fitness: Keeping track of injuries or suspensions is vital for predicting team strength.
  • External Factors: Weather conditions and venue choices can significantly impact game dynamics.

Additionally, it can be tempting to follow popular betting trends or advice from social media without examining the validity of that information. This often leads to decisions based on hype rather than solid analytics. To build a reliable betting strategy, it’s crucial to incorporate a wider range of research methodologies, such as:

  • Statistical Analysis: Delve into advanced metrics that provide insights beyond basic stats.
  • Expert Opinions: Seek insights from seasoned analysts and professionals in the field.
  • Community Feedback: Engage in discussions with fellow bettors to gather diverse perspectives.

Q&A: Common Mistakes in Soccer Betting

Q1: What are some of the most common mistakes beginners make when betting on soccer?

A1: One of the biggest pitfalls for newcomers is betting with their hearts instead of their heads. Many fans place wagers based on emotional attachments to their favorite teams rather than analyzing statistical data and form. This leads to biased decisions rather than informed betting.


Q2: How important is it to do proper research before placing a bet?

A2: Proper research is crucial. Analyzing team form, player injuries, head-to-head statistics, and even weather conditions can significantly impact a match’s outcome. Without adequate research, you’re essentially throwing darts in the dark.


Q3: What about bankroll management? Why is that a mistake often overlooked?

A3: Bankroll management is one of the cornerstones of successful betting that many overlook. Betting too large a percentage of your bankroll on a single match can lead to quick losses. A common rule of thumb is to wager only 1-5% of your total bankroll on a single bet. This approach ensures longevity in betting, even when luck isn’t on your side.


Q4: Is it wise to bet on every match in a league just for the sake of it?

A4: Betting on every match may sound tempting, but it’s a quick ticket to a financial pitfall. Not every game offers value, and too many bets can diffuse attention and lead to subpar choices. It’s better to be selective and focus on matches where you see an advantage based on research.


Q5: How does chasing losses affect betting decisions?

A5: Chasing losses is one of the most dangerous habits a bettor can develop. After a losing streak, it’s easy to become desperate and place larger bets in an attempt to recover losses. This often leads to even greater losses and poor decision-making. A disciplined approach is key; it’s important to stick to your strategy and not let emotions dictate your actions.


Q6: What role do odds play in soccer betting mistakes?

A6: Understanding odds is crucial for effective betting, yet many bettors fail to calculate their real value. Some mistakenly bet on favorites without considering whether the odds genuinely reflect the team’s chances of winning. Conversely, others may ignore betting opportunities on underdogs that offer better value. Always assess whether a bet’s potential reward justifies the risk involved.


Q7: Should I pay attention to public sentiment when placing bets?

A7: While public sentiment can influence odds and may provide insights into general trends, betting solely based on popular opinion can lead to mistakes. Often, markets will move in favor of public favorites, which may overvalue them. It’s beneficial to balance public perception with your analyses and insights.


Q8: How can I avoid making emotional decisions when betting?

A8: Developing a betting plan that includes specific criteria for when and how much to wager can help neutralize emotions. Setting aside a particular budget for betting and establishing clear strategies, such as focusing on specific leagues or types of bets, can maintain a more analytical mindset. Remember: betting should be treated like a business.


Q9: What advice would you give to someone experiencing consistent losses?

A9: If you’re finding yourself in a losing streak, it’s a good idea to take a step back. Review your betting strategy critically—perhaps you need to refine your research methods or adjust the way you manage your bankroll. Sometimes, taking a break from betting entirely can reset your mindset and allow you to return with clearer thoughts and fresh strategies.
